Quantum Gap
The realm of quantum mechanics presents a profound enigma to our traditional understanding of reality. This fundamental divide arises from the contrasting nature of the quantum and classical worlds. While classical science governs our everyday experiences, quantum theory prescribes the behavior of particles at the subatomic level. This difference gives rise to events that contradict our common intuition, such as entanglement.
